SEO Strategies: Driving Organic Growth in 2024

Search Engine Optimization (SEO) remains one of the most effective ways to enhance a website’s visibility, attract organic traffic, and improve overall digital performance. As search engines continue to evolve, so too must SEO strategies. This article explores some of the most effective SEO strategies for 2024 to ensure businesses stay competitive in an increasingly digital landscape.

1. Focus on User Experience (UX)

In recent years, Google has placed increasing importance on user experience, and this trend is set to continue in 2024. Core Web Vitals—Google’s page experience signals—are key factors in this evaluation. These metrics assess the loading speed, interactivity, and visual stability of web pages. Websites that prioritize faster load times, mobile optimization, and clean, easy-to-navigate layouts will perform better in search engine rankings.

Additionally, user-friendly content, logical site structures, and a focus on accessibility will ensure users remain engaged. A positive user experience leads to higher engagement, reducing bounce rates, and enhancing time spent on-site—signals that search engines use to evaluate a site’s relevance and authority.

2. Content Optimization and E-A-T

Creating high-quality, relevant, and well-optimized content remains at the core of any SEO strategy. In 2024, this strategy is refined further by Google’s E-A-T (Expertise, Authoritativeness, and Trustworthiness) principles, which evaluate the credibility of content creators and the information presented.

Businesses should aim to produce authoritative content that solves problems and answers questions specific to their target audience. Updating old content with fresh information, better keyword alignment, and internal linking can also boost SEO performance. Long-form, well-researched content tends to rank higher, especially when it includes rich media such as images, infographics, and videos.

3. Voice Search Optimization

As more users turn to virtual assistants like Siri, Alexa, and Google Assistant, optimizing content for voice search is becoming essential. Voice search queries are typically longer and more conversational than traditional text searches. Businesses should therefore focus on natural language keywords and question-based phrases that align with how people speak.

Local businesses can benefit particularly from voice search by optimizing for “near me” queries and ensuring their Google My Business profile is up to date. Including schema markup on websites can also help voice assistants pull relevant information more effectively.

4. Mobile-First Indexing

Google has officially moved to mobile-first indexing, meaning the mobile version of a website is considered the primary version for indexing and ranking. This shift means that ensuring your site is mobile-friendly is no longer optional but essential for SEO success.

Mobile SEO involves optimizing page speed for mobile devices, ensuring the site is responsive, and eliminating intrusive pop-ups that might interfere with the user experience on smaller screens. Structured data should also be implemented correctly on mobile sites to ensure better indexing and ranking.

5. AI and Automation in SEO

Artificial Intelligence (AI) and machine learning are becoming integral parts of SEO. Google’s RankBrain, an AI-driven algorithm, is designed to better understand search queries and user intent, which means SEO efforts must be smarter. Optimizing content for intent, rather than just focusing on keywords, will be crucial in 2024.

Tools powered by AI, like chatbots, predictive analytics, and automated reporting tools, are also helping SEOs become more efficient. These tools can analyze data at scale, making it easier to identify opportunities, understand competitors, and adjust strategies accordingly.

6. Building High-Quality Backlinks

Backlinks continue to be a cornerstone of SEO success. However, quality matters more than quantity in 2024. Earning backlinks from reputable, authoritative websites in your industry will improve your site’s domain authority, helping it rank higher.

Guest blogging, producing shareable infographics, and collaborating with influencers or experts in your niche are effective ways to build high-quality backlinks. Be wary of black-hat SEO tactics like purchasing low-quality links, as Google’s algorithms are becoming increasingly sophisticated at detecting and penalizing manipulative practices.

7. Local SEO and “Near Me” Searches

Local SEO has grown in importance, especially for businesses with physical locations. In 2024, local SEO efforts should focus on optimizing Google My Business listings, acquiring local backlinks, and encouraging customer reviews. Local businesses should also optimize their content for location-based keywords and ensure consistent NAP (Name, Address, Phone Number) citations across online platforms.

Google’s local pack, which showcases businesses near the user’s location, is critical for driving foot traffic. Local SEO also plays a key role in voice search optimization, as users frequently look for local services through voice-activated devices.

8. The Role of Video in SEO

Video content is surging in popularity, and search engines are responding by giving video results prominent placements on results pages. Businesses should consider integrating video content into their SEO strategies in 2024. This could include product demonstrations, how-to guides, or educational content hosted on platforms like YouTube or directly on their websites.

Optimizing video content with appropriate titles, descriptions, and tags will help it rank in both YouTube searches and Google’s video carousel. Additionally, embedding video into web pages can boost the page’s overall engagement and dwell time, improving its SEO performance.

Conclusion

SEO in 2024 is all about creating a user-centric approach, leveraging the latest technological advances, and staying ahead of evolving search engine algorithms. By focusing on user experience, high-quality content, mobile-first strategies, voice search, and backlink building, businesses can strengthen their online presence and maintain a competitive edge. SEO is a long-term investment, but with the right strategies in place, it can deliver sustainable growth and increased visibility in the digital marketplace.
